Question
which represents an exterior angle of triangle egf?
○ ∠meg
○ ∠neg
○ ∠peq
○ ∠rfs
Brief Explanations
To determine the exterior angle of triangle \( EGF \), we recall that an exterior angle of a triangle is formed by one side of the triangle and the extension of another side. Let's analyze each option:
- \( \angle MEG \): This angle is related to line \( MQ \) and \( EP \), not directly an exterior angle of \( \triangle EGF \).
- \( \angle NEG \): This angle is formed at vertex \( E \), between \( NE \) and \( EG \). When we extend a side of \( \triangle EGF \) (e.g., \( EG \) or \( EF \)), \( \angle NEG \) is an exterior angle because it is adjacent to an interior angle of \( \triangle EGF \) and forms a linear pair with it.
- \( \angle PEQ \): This is a vertical or adjacent angle on line \( MQ \), not related to \( \triangle EGF \).
- \( \angle RFS \): This angle is at vertex \( F \) but not related to the sides of \( \triangle EGF \).
